Mahomes Robbed at Gunpoint
 
SMITH COUNTY, TX (KLTV) -
Patrick Mahomes II was reportedly robbed at gunpoint in Smith County on Friday.

On May 12, Smith County Sheriff's deputies were dispatched to a residence located in the 8800 block of Mansion Creek Circle in reference to an Aggravated Robbery.

Upon arrival deputies met with four individuals who stated that they had been robbed by a white male suspect who they believed to be armed with a handgun. One of the individuals robbed was Mr. Patrick Mahomes II.

As the victims were getting out of their vehicle, the suspect pulled into the driveway.

As the suspect approached the victims, he was seen gesturing as if he had a handgun in his waistband. The suspect then demanded property from the victims.

The suspect fled the location in his vehicle.

After deputies arrived and spoke with the victims they were able to locate the suspect's vehicle which was occupied by two males. A stop of the vehicle was performed near County Road 273 and Malisa Circle.

Two suspects were taken into custody. Michael Blake Pinkerton, 34, and Billy Ray Johnson, 58, were both arrested and taken to the Smith County Jail.

No one was injured. Property taken during the robbery was recovered from the suspect’s vehicle.

The Smith County Sheriff's Office says the investigation is active and ongoing.
